How To Calibrate Your Brand Identity Using Social Media Marketing?

We are living in a competitive era where everyone desires to get a piece of cake.  However, the businesses need to work hard to stand apart from the herd. One of the best ways to achieve this goal is to create a unique brand voice for the company- that will appeal to the customers and get noticed by the SEO community. 


What do you mean by a brand voice?

It is a voice or message that demonstrates your core values and what you wish to convey to the target customers.  It must remain consistent in different communication forms like blogs, social media marketing, adverts, etc. If your marketing strategy is not able to stand consistently, you will lose the loyalty factor.   The article provides insight on how social media marketing can help you raise a voice and turn Google algorithms in your favor. 

1. Create social media page

A social media page can effectively help you to syndicate the content and improve the business visibility. Implementing the strategy will help you to connect with the audience engagingly. The employees, the business partners, can easily interact with the audience and create brand awareness. Every post will be introduced to a new network of customers and more and more people will know your business. By investing a few hours, your business will get huge exposure.

2. Add live marketing campaigns

Live Marketing campaigns are incredibly effective in marketing the products. You can create these events to encourage your brand campaign. These campaigns will help you to target the real audience. 

3. Run contests to up your social media campaign.

Creating a contest is one of the most attractive tactics that you can use to improve your online visibility, followers, and engagement level.  Many social tools are available in the market to craft contests and to create a giveaway. It will tremendously add to the voice of your brand. 

Social media is the key to let your brand voice heard

You can use these strategies to attract potential customers in this era of cut-throat competition.
